1. Google Fonts (https://fonts.google.com/)
Why Use Google Fonts?
Completely free for personal and commercial use.
Huge collection of high-quality fonts.
Easy to preview and download.
Google Fonts is a great starting point for simple and clean font styles that work well for t-shirts. Some recommended fonts for name and number printing include Oswald, Bebas Neue, and Anton.
2. DaFont (https://www.dafont.com/)
Why Use DaFont?
Wide variety of font styles, including sports, handwritten, and decorative fonts.
Many free fonts available for personal use.
Easy search by category and theme.
If you're looking for bold and athletic fonts for jersey-style numbers, check out fonts like Varsity, College, or Athletic on DaFont.

How to Choose the Right Font for Your Class Tee?
When selecting a font for personalized name and number printing, consider these factors:
Readability: Make sure the font is easy to read from a distance.
Style: Match the font with your class theme—formal, sporty, or fun.
Thickness: Bold fonts work best for printing, especially on darker fabrics.
Legibility on Fabric: Avoid overly intricate fonts that may not print well on t-shirts.
